Hon. Adeola Fynch Visits Ago-Ireti, Rallies Support for Aiyedatiwa, Distributes Palliatives

On Tuesday, October 29, 2024, Hon. Adeola Fynch, Special Assistant to the Ondo State Governor, paid a visit to the Ago-Ireti community in Akure to distribute palliatives to vulnerable residents. The visit was part of a larger effort by her team to support communities facing economic hardship and ensure their basic needs are met. The palliatives, which included food items and essential household supplies, were well-received by the grateful residents.

Accompanied by a delegation from the All Progressives Congress (APC) USA Chapter, Hon. Adeola emphasized the importance of supporting the administration’s efforts to provide relief to those in need. During the event, she addressed the crowd, urging them to vote for Governor Lucky Aiyedatiwa in the forthcoming elections. According to her, continuity in leadership is key to ensuring the ongoing development projects and social programs initiated by the current administration.

In her speech, Hon. Adeola, the Akure born business tycoon praised the achievements of Governor Aiyedatiwa’s administration, highlighting various infrastructure projects, health initiatives, and social interventions that have positively impacted the state.
She stressed that re-electing Aiyedatiwa would ensure the continuity of these programs, which are aimed at improving the quality of life for all residents, especially the most vulnerable. “Governor Aiyedatiwa has laid a solid foundation for progress, and it is crucial that we allow him to finish what he has started,” she said.

The visit also saw members of the APC USA Chapter express their support for Governor Aiyedatiwa’s candidacy. They commended Hon. Fynch for her commitment to grassroots engagement and her efforts to bring relief to underserved communities. They pledged to continue working with local leaders to promote the values and goals of the APC both within Nigeria and abroad.

The residents of Ago Ireti reiterated their support for Gov. Lucky Orimisan Aiyedatiwa, promising to deliver massive votes for the governor come November 16.
